Advances in superconducting magnets for high energy and astroparticle physics

Description

Superconducting magnets for particle detectors have been developed to provide high and large magnetic field volume with minimum material and space in the detector systems. This paper overview progress of the detector magnets in high-energy physics and astroparticle physics, and discusses about key technologies such as aluminum-stabilized superconductor
